What Could China Give to and Take from Other Countries in Terms of the Development of the Biogas Industry?

Abstract: Anaerobic digestion is one of the most sustainable and promising technologies for the management of organic residues. China plays an important role in the world's biogas industry and has accumulated rich and valuable experience, both positive and negative. The country has established relatively complete laws, policies and a subsidy system; its world-renowned standard system guarantees the implementation of biogas projects. China has developed many types of household biogas digesters since the 1980s to overcome the weaknesses of traditional brick and concrete digesters (Lei et al 2020). Among all the traditional digesters, the Chinese dome digester is the most popular one due to its reliability.…”

“…It has become a standard for the design of domestic prefabricated digesters like the Puxin digester (Jegede et al 2019). The most common prefabricated biogas digesters in China are flexible plastic digesters and composite material digesters (Lei et al 2020). Flexible plastic digesters are very efficient due to their low cost and ease of implementation and use.…”
